Output 113c959250f2655c7158385c94f55ab1d00912262396de32e8a698b46b2ee84b:15

value
6468513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7f2b7b0c27b1c9e472a73d1af5ca857d0f1f83 OP_EQUAL
address
MU6KujuR8bG5o9bEgd882SDzsCd6DVf1ii
transaction
113c959250f2655c7158385c94f55ab1d00912262396de32e8a698b46b2ee84b
spent
true